Definition

  1. 1
    Bahnhof
  2. 2
    Beförderung
  3. 3
    Beifahrer/Beifahrerin
  4. 4
    Beruf
  5. 5
    Beschwerdeführer
  6. 6
    Bischof
  7. 7
    Brief
